Hey guys soo I've been searching around ( I tried here but the search tool keeps coming up empty) online for scope mounts for my Marlin 1895 45/70, now I really like the look of the XS lever rail system but I'm concerned about it's aluminium construction and longevity. Is this a legitimate concern? Or would traditional steel rings be best? The scope I'm leaning hard towards is the nikkon pro staff played around with a bunch at the store and I liked that one the best. I'm still learning and pretty new so any help would be appreciated thanks
 
Leupold steel one piece base ..........I put a 4x Leupold on mine and can cut 1/2" groups with handloads in either 300gr HP or 350gr FN
 
I have had an XS rail on mine for years and it has never failed. And I use this rifle a lot.

Similar setup and testing results for me with a low power leupold scope.
The beauty is the bullets hit 2" high at 100 yards and at 200 yards you use the tip of the lower post thick part of the crosshair before it tappers and it's bang on .
 
My loads in a pre safety Marlin ..use only in strong 45-70 class guns......not MAX.......use at own risk Hornady 350gr /44gr IMR4198/Win brass/Fed LRP .504" 3 shot group @ 100 yards Hornady 300gr HP/54gr IMR3031/same brass + primer .536"3 shot group at 100 yards
 
I believe XS makes the rail that Marlin uses on the SBL? That is the ultimate solution; a long continuous pic rail that allows the use of standard scopes, scout scopes, red dots or anything else you desire,,,plus a fully-adjustable rear aperture sight in case you don't want any optic.
